Understanding Joe Pye Weed
Joe Pye weed is a perennial wildflower native to eastern North America, but its adaptability has allowed it to thrive in various climates, including the subtropical conditions of Karnataka. This herbaceous plant is known for its distinctive purple-pink flower clusters that bloom during the summer and attract a wide range of pollinators, making it an invaluable addition to any garden or agricultural setting.
Beyond its aesthetic appeal, Joe Pye weed has a long history of medicinal uses, with its roots and leaves being used to treat a variety of ailments, from fevers and coughs to kidney and urinary tract disorders. In the context of human welfare, the cultivation of this plant can provide a valuable source of natural remedies, contributing to the well-being of local communities.

Water and pH Control
Maintaining the appropriate water quality and pH levels is critical for the successful cultivation of Joe Pye weed in a hydroponic system. The water should be free of contaminants and have a pH range between 6.0 and 7.0, which is ideal for the plant’s nutrient uptake and overall health. Constant monitoring and adjustments to the pH and water quality are essential to prevent any imbalances that could hinder plant growth.
Lighting and Environmental Control
Joe Pye weed thrives in well-lit environments, requiring a minimum of six hours of direct sunlight per day. In a hydroponic system, supplemental lighting may be necessary to ensure optimal light exposure, especially during periods of reduced natural sunlight. Additionally, maintaining the appropriate temperature, humidity, and air circulation within the growing environment is crucial for the plant’s overall health and development.
